Package | Description |
---|---|
com.yahoo.document |
Modifier and Type | Field and Description |
---|---|
private List<FieldPathEntry> |
FieldPath.list |
Modifier and Type | Method and Description |
---|---|
FieldPathEntry |
FieldPath.get(int index) |
static FieldPathEntry |
FieldPathEntry.newAllKeysLookupEntry(DataType resultingDataType)
Creates a new field path entry that digs through all the keys of a map or weighted set.
|
static FieldPathEntry |
FieldPathEntry.newAllValuesLookupEntry(DataType resultingDataType)
Creates a new field path entry that digs through all the values of a map or weighted set.
|
static FieldPathEntry |
FieldPathEntry.newArrayLookupEntry(int lookupIndex,
DataType resultingDataType)
Creates a new field path entry that references an array index.
|
static FieldPathEntry |
FieldPathEntry.newMapLookupEntry(FieldValue lookupKey,
DataType resultingDataType)
Creates a new field path entry that references a map or weighted set.
|
static FieldPathEntry |
FieldPathEntry.newStructFieldEntry(Field fieldRef)
Creates a new field path entry that references a struct field.
|
static FieldPathEntry |
FieldPathEntry.newVariableLookupEntry(String variableName,
DataType resultingDataType)
Creates a new field path entry that digs through all the keys in a map or weighted set, or all the indexes of an array,
an sets the given variable name as it does so (or, if the variable is set, uses the set variable to look up the
collection.
|
Modifier and Type | Method and Description |
---|---|
List<FieldPathEntry> |
FieldPath.getList() |
Iterator<FieldPathEntry> |
FieldPath.iterator() |
Constructor and Description |
---|
FieldPath(List<FieldPathEntry> path) |
Copyright © 2018. All rights reserved.